The recipe is here: http://camprecipes.com/recipe-Chicken-Foil-270
It's very flexible. I usually chop up veggies of my choice and put them together in a container. I also tend to use cream of mushroom soup, but your mileage will vary. Also, don't be afraid to use a quarter cup of rice in the mix, and double the liquid.
If you don't use a ready-made foil bag, use heavy-duty foil, and make sure to double up the bag created. That will prevent any leakage. :)
